Atletico Madrid will play their first competitive fixture of the season in Wednesday night’s UEFA Super Cup, their first since taking on Eibar in LaLiga on May 20.

Some thought that the final LaLiga match of the 2017/18 season would be Antoine Griezmann’s last one in an Atleti shirt, but he is back and ready to wear his No.7 jersey once again.

He announced he’d be staying in a mini-documentary called ‘The Decision’, which not everybody loved.
What Atletico fans did love was the ending, when the Frenchman revealed he would stay in the Spanish capital.

Besides a salary increase, his conditions were for Atletico to improve their facilities and to improve their squad.
They are working on the first requirement, while they have succeeded with the second by signing several talented players during the summer months.

Griezmann and Diego Simeone now have a squad that can compete for all titles, like this Wednesday’s one.

Of course, Griezmann is the crown jewel and it’s so important for Los Rojiblancos that he features in Tallinn against Real Madrid.

Although he has only been back for 10 days after helping France to World Cup glory, when it’s recommended he trains for 15 days before an elite match, he is ready to go.

Simeone knows that these matches are all about emotion and even said so during his press conference, so it’s important for the forward to be on the pitch and to try to make something happen.

Now the third captain of the team, Griezmann will be even more of a leader this season and he’ll be the one who many of his teammates look to against Los Blancos, a team he has enjoyed plenty of success against.

In 17 matches against Real Madrid with Atletico, Griezmann has won six, drawn eight and lost three, while scoring seven goals, including the most recent.

In UEFA matches, he is the player to have scored five of his team’s past eight goals and was the driving force of their Europa League triumph.

Because of that and because of the World Cup, he is a Ballon d’Or candidate and is he’ll hope to win a third final in a row in Estonia.

It marks the official beginning of a new era for Los Blancos as Julen Lopetegui takes charge of his first competitive game since taking over from Zinedine Zidane and the former Spain boss will be eager to get off on the right foot by securing some silverware.

The competition has been dominated by Spanish clubs over the course of the last decade, with Champions League holders Real winning three of the last four editions, while Atletico triumphed in 2010 and 2012.Real arguably hold the bragging rights over Atletico having defeated them in the 2014 and 2016 Champions League finals, so Diego Simeone’s men are out to prove a point.

Lopetegui has brought a 29-man squad with him to Estonia and one of the notable inclusions was Luka Modric, whose future has been subject to intense speculation in recent weeks.

New signings Thibaut Courtois and Vinicius Jr. could be in line to make their competitive debuts, but Alvaro Odriozola has been ruled out. Of course, for the first time in nine years there will be no Cristiano Ronaldo in Real’s ranks.

Potential Real Madrid XI: Courtois; Carvajal, Varane, Ramos, Marcelo; Casemiro, Kroos, Asensio; Bale, Isco, Benzema.

Diego Simeone has a full squad available and the game could see new signings Thomas Lemar and Nikola Kalinic make an appearance.

Potential Atletico Madrid XI: Oblak; Juanfran, Luis, Godin, Gimenez; Saul, Koke, Lemar; Griezmann, Gelson, Costa.
